Description

1,1'-Biphenyl, 4-[Difluoro(3,4,5-Trifluorophenoxy)Methyl]-4'-(trans-4-Ethylcyclohexyl)-3,5-Difluoro- is a highly fluorinated biphenyl derivative engineered for advanced material science applications. This compound matters for its role as a key liquid crystal (LC) monomer or intermediate, offering precise molecular geometry and electronic properties essential for next-generation displays. It is primarily needed by manufacturers in the electronics and optoelectronics industries for developing high-performance liquid crystal mixtures.

Basic Information

Product Name 1,1'-Biphenyl, 4-[Difluoro(3,4,5-Trifluorophenoxy)Methyl]-4'-(trans-4-Ethylcyclohexyl)-3,5-Difluoro-
CAS No. 303186-21-2
Molecular Formula C27H23F7O
Molecular Weight 496.46 g/mol
